The Passion of Christ Collection

Easter of 2004, painters, musicians, writers and spoken word artists came together to celebrate Christ's passion at The Well. The story of his passions came alive in our hearts again as we witnessed the intimacy of his last supper with his disciples, the anguish of the garden, his betrayal with a kiss, the hysteria of the mob at his trial, his soulful sojourn on that road to calvary, his anguished cry as he took God's wrath on the cross, and finally his triumphal resurrection from the tomb.

These pieces of art were rendered live during the service and continue to grace the walls of our sanctuary as a memorial to Christ's loving sacrifice. These paintings hang in this on-line gallery, not for the admiration of their beauty alone, but that Christ's beauty might be admired and adored.

Featured Artists: Silas Clarke, Cate Jones, Sarah Nordbye
Art Direction: Jim Andrew
